ITIN Requirements for Mobile App Developers in Zambia

Mobile app developers in Zambia face a specific challenge when earning income from U.S.-based platforms like Apple App Store and Google Play Store. These platforms require you to submit U.S. tax information to comply with Internal Revenue Service (IRS) regulations, particularly concerning withholding taxes on royalties and payments. For developers who do not have, and are not eligible for, a U.S. Social Security Number (SSN), the Individual Taxpayer Identification Number (ITIN) is the required alternative. This ITIN serves as your unique tax identification number for U.S. tax purposes, enabling platforms to correctly report your earnings and withhold taxes at the appropriate rate. Without it, you may face a higher withholding tax rate of 30% on your U.S. source income, significantly impacting your net earnings. Understanding the ITIN application process is therefore critical for mobile app developers in Zambia looking to maximize their income from global app markets.

When You Need an ITIN as a Mobile App Developer

An ITIN is triggered for mobile app developers in Zambia primarily by the payment and reporting requirements of U.S. digital marketplaces. Apple and Google, for instance, mandate that all developers receiving payments for apps, in-app purchases, or subscriptions provide U.S. tax identification. If you are not a U.S. citizen or a U.S. resident alien, you will not have an SSN. In this scenario, the ITIN becomes the necessary substitute. This requirement applies whether you are operating as an individual or through a business entity that is not itself subject to U.S. tax reporting. The platforms use this information to file Form 1099 or similar reports with the IRS, detailing your income. Failing to provide a valid U.S. tax ID, whether an SSN or ITIN, will result in the highest applicable withholding tax rate being applied to your earnings, as per IRS regulations.

Required Documentation for Your ITIN Application

To apply for an ITIN, you must complete and submit IRS Form W-7, Application for IRS Individual Taxpayer Identification Number. This form requires your full legal name, address, and other identifying information. Crucially, Form W-7 must be accompanied by original identification documents or certified copies of those documents. The IRS mandates that you provide proof of your identity and foreign status. For most applicants, a valid U.S. passport is the preferred document as it serves as both proof of identity and foreign status. If a passport is unavailable or expired, other documents like a national identity card, driver's license, or birth certificate may be used in combination with other documents to establish both identity and foreign status. You will also need to include a U.S. tax return unless you qualify for an exception, such as applying with a tax treaty benefit claim (though no U.S.-Zambia treaty exists for income tax purposes) or applying for an exception to the return-filing requirement. For mobile app developers in Zambia, ensure your passport is current and matches the name you use on all tax forms.

Common Mistakes for Mobile App Developers in Zambia

Mobile app developers in Zambia often encounter specific pitfalls when applying for an ITIN. A frequent error is submitting photocopies of identification documents instead of original or certified copies. The IRS requires original documents or certified copies from the issuing agency to prevent fraud. Another common issue is an incomplete Form W-7, with missing information or signatures, which can lead to delays or rejection. Furthermore, failing to include a valid U.S. tax return with your Form W-7 application, unless you qualify for an exception, is a primary reason for denial. Since there is no U.S.-Zambia income tax treaty, developers cannot claim treaty benefits to expedite their application in that manner. Ensure all information on Form W-7 precisely matches your supporting identification documents, especially your legal name and date of birth. Mismatched information is a leading cause of application rejection.

Next Steps After Obtaining Your ITIN

Once you receive your ITIN from the IRS via notice CP-565, you must provide it to the platforms that require it, such as Apple and Google. Update your tax information settings within your developer accounts on these platforms. This ensures that future royalty payments are taxed at the correct, and potentially lower, rate rather than the default 30% non-withholding rate. You will also need to file a U.S. tax return annually using your ITIN if you continue to earn U.S. source income. Consider consulting with a U.S. tax professional specializing in non-resident taxation to ensure ongoing compliance. Frequently asked questions

Do I need an ITIN if I only develop apps for personal use and don't monetize them?

No, an ITIN is generally only required if you are earning income from U.S. sources that platforms like Apple or Google need to report to the IRS. If your apps are not monetized and you do not receive payments from U.S. platforms, you likely do not need an ITIN.

How long does it take to get an ITIN if I mail my application directly to the IRS?

Mailing your application directly to the IRS can take several weeks to a few months. The exact processing time can vary depending on the IRS's current workload and the completeness of your application. Using a Certified Acceptance Agent can often expedite this timeline.

Can I use my Zambian national ID as proof of identity for my ITIN application?

A Zambian national ID may be accepted as proof of identity, but it must be used in conjunction with other documents to establish your foreign status. A valid passport is preferred by the IRS as it typically serves as proof of both identity and foreign status. It is best to check the latest IRS guidance on acceptable documentation.

What happens if I don't provide a U.S. tax ID to Apple or Google?

If you do not provide a U.S. tax identification number (either an SSN or an ITIN) to platforms like Apple or Google, they are required by the IRS to withhold taxes at the highest applicable rate, which is currently 30%, on your U.S. source income. This significantly reduces your earnings.

Is there a U.S.-Zambia income tax treaty that affects my ITIN application?

No, there is no U.S.-Zambia income tax treaty that provides for reduced withholding rates or simplifies the ITIN application process through treaty benefits. You will apply for the ITIN based on the standard requirements for non-residents.

Can I apply for an ITIN if I have never filed a U.S. tax return before?

Generally, you must file a U.S. tax return with your Form W-7 to obtain an ITIN. However, there are exceptions, such as applying for an ITIN to claim treaty benefits or if you are applying for an exception to the return-filing requirement. For most mobile app developers earning income, filing a tax return is necessary.
